Member of the Observatory for Transparency and Good Governance said the cell phone of MP Noureddine Bhiri was stolen.
Speaking to Jawhara FM,Mansour concluded that the phone would hold valuable information that could be used by journalists and the media.
He also said that Bhiri would be afraid of what this phone, probably containing private correspondence, might reveal.
